
Satu Kähkönen is a Visiting Fellow at the University of Ghent (Belgium) and a Postdoctoral Researcher (PhD) working at the Department of Art and Culture Studies, University of Jyväskylä, Finland. Her current research focuses on the concept of cultural environment in Finnish heritage and environmental administration and regional and local cultural environment programs prepared in different parts of Finland. In addition, Kähkönen conducts comparative research with CHeriScape (a landscape-focused network funded as part of the transnational pilot call of the European Joint Programming Initiative on Cultural Heritage, University of Ghent) on territorial meanings of cultural heritage and national, regional and local heritage management plans and programs in Finland, Belgium and other CHeriScape partner countries.
